Projects
From 02/2005 to 03/2008, Chitosan-apatite biomaterials for bone replacement
This project focused on synthesis and in-vivo evaluation of new one step co-preparation biomaterials based on chitosan and apatite (ChAp). Funded by Sumy State University, Ukraine
From 02/2009 to 09/2010, Materials for wound treatment
The aim of project is creation of new biocompatibility biomaterials based on chitosan for skin replacement. Supported by President of Ukraine Grant for Biomaterial Development Researches, Ukraine
From 09/2011 to 10/2012, Biomaterial for dura mater closure
Supported by "Biocomposite", Ukraine
From 09/2012 to 05/2014, Trace element sorption by the chitosan-based materials
Funded by Sumy State University, Ukraine
